In Japanese media, an otomari (sleepover) is a classic plot device. It strips away the buffer of school or public settings, forcing characters into domestic proximity. When combined with the shinseki (relative) dynamic, it taps into the heavily saturated "childhood friend" or "reunited cousins" trope common in visual novels and dating simulators.
